Packaged Heat/Cool Systems like this 5-Ton unit adds significant, concentrated weight to a roof such that pooling water and ponding areas develop over time. These areas require significant repair effort, including adding under-roof structural supports or building up the ponding roof areas. Standing water will ruin any roof system in short order…

Then there are the areas where builders have not paid attention to their roof design or their building process. We find a lot of roofs that have significant ponding areas that should never have been allowed. Shoddy craftsmanship. The solution(s)?
(1) Repair the structure,
(2) Add a roof drain,
(3) Build-up the roof system forcing ponding water to perimeter roof drains, or
(4) sometimes ALL THREE…

Drains and Water-Ways need the most attention. Water-Ways like the area below – where rain water collects against the parapet wall on its way to one of the four corner drains – these need repairs, build-ups and strengthening…
